Fulgent Genetics (FLGT) reported its fiscal 2025 Q2 earnings on Aug 01st, 2025. Fulgent GeneticsFLGT-- exceeded revenue expectations with a 15.2% increase to $81.80 million, while the net income results fell short. The company raised its revenue guidance for 2025 from $310 million to $320 million, indicating positive expectations for the rest of the year. However, the earnings per share guidance was adjusted to reflect a greater loss, aligning with current challenges.
Revenue
The total revenue of Fulgent Genetics increased by 15.2% to $81.80 million in 2025 Q2, up from $71.03 million in 2024 Q2.
Earnings/Net Income
Fulgent Genetics's losses deepened to $0.62 per share in 2025 Q2 from a loss of $0.29 per share in 2024 Q2 (113.8% wider loss). Meanwhile, the company's net loss widened to $-19.26 million in 2025 Q2, representing a 111.8% increase from the $-9.09 million loss recorded in 2024 Q2. The widened loss reflects ongoing financial challenges.

CEO Commentary
Ming Hsieh, Chairman & CEO, expressed satisfaction with Fulgent Genetics' second-quarter results, noting "sequential and year-over-year growth in laboratory services." He highlighted the ongoing progress in their therapeutic development pipeline, specifically mentioning that their first clinical candidate, FID-007, is advancing through a Phase II trial. Hsieh emphasized the importance of addressing patient needs, stating, "These drug candidates address heavily pretreated patients with very few options left." He conveyed optimism about the company's financial position and strategic execution, affirming, "We look forward to further progress in the second half of 2025."
Guidance
Fulgent Genetics raised its revenue outlook for 2025 from $310 million to $320 million, indicating a growth of 14% year-over-year. The company anticipates non-GAAP gross margins to slightly exceed 40% for the full year and expects non-GAAP operating margins to improve from -15% to -13%. The revised non-GAAP EPS guidance is projected to be a loss of $0.35 per share, while GAAP EPS guidance is adjusted to a loss of $2.10 per share. The company expects to end 2025 with approximately $770 million in cash and equivalents.
Additional News
Fulgent Genetics (FLGT) has recently made significant strides in its business operations. The company announced a strategic partnership with Foundation Medicine to launch new germline tests in the U.S., enhancing its diagnostic offerings for hereditary cancers. Additionally, Fulgent achieved CE certification under the EU's In Vitro Diagnostic Regulation for its germline sequencing system, potentially expanding its market reach in Europe. Furthermore, Fulgent continues to maintain a strong cash position, evidenced by substantial share repurchases, signaling confidence in its financial strategy and long-term growth prospects. These developments highlight Fulgent's commitment to expanding its footprint in precision medicine and diagnostics.
